Embodiment 1
[0067] The structure of a kind of automatic putty scraping machine of the present embodiment is as follows: Figure 1 to Figure 12 Shown include:
[0068] a drive chassis 1 for driving the entire device on a plane,
[0069] a smoothing mechanism 2 for smoothing the putty on the wall,
[0070] A grouting mechanism 3 for spraying putty on the wall,
[0071] A stirring mechanism 4 for stirring putty;
[0072] A driving mechanism 5 for driving the smoothing mechanism 2 to move up and down in the vertical direction;
[0073] The spraying mechanism 3, the mixing mechanism 4, the smoothing mechanism 2 and the driving mechanism 5 are all installed on the driving chassis 1, and the driving chassis 1 can also store putty powder and stirring agent after the above components are installed;
[0074] Stirring mechanism 4 can stir the mixture of putty powder and stirring agent into putty;

Embodiment 2
[0107] The spray port 241 is arranged on two adjacent paddles 211. In order to prevent the putty from the spray port 241 from spraying onto the paddle 211 when the paddle 211 is rotating, the putty sprayed from the spray port 241 is sprayed non-continuously, controlled by the program The operating frequency of the smoothing motor 22 and the pump body 31, the smoothing motor 22 drives the rotary trowel 21 to rotate half a circle, and the pump body 31 sprays putty once on the wall between two adjacent paddles 211, avoiding the paddles 211, effectively avoiding the spraying of putty to the paddle 211.
